No you don’t Just remove the tapered pin that holds the joint to the strut. It’s about 3 inches above the top of the joint and costs about $12. You need to use a drift to drive it out or cut the threaded end off flush. You don’t even want to “mushroom the end They can’t be reused but simpler than the joint. Anyway, you would have to just remove the nut on the bottom of the joint not separate the joint. New nut and star washer about $12
